4.0 out of 5 stars Works if you use it properly, November 25, 2010
By 
Susan Ernst (Leesburg, VA United States)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: OXO Good Grips Turkey Baster with Cleaning Brush (Kitchen)
I was having the same frustrating problem with the bulb and collar falling off. Like those of you who are familiar with the superior tools from Oxo, it didn't make sense that this was due to poor design. I was convinced I was using it wrong, especially after reading reviews from those who love it. Sure enough, after experimenting, I found that you have to use it like a true syringe, by putting two fingers underneath the collar, while pushing down on the bulb with your thumb--works beautifully! If you just squeeze the bulb without holding the collar, everything falls apart. I gave this four starts, because Oxo should emphasize this little nuance on the packaging.

1.0 out of 5 stars Save your money!, October 12, 2007
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
This review is from: OXO Good Grips Turkey Baster with Cleaning Brush (Kitchen)
The OXO Good Grips Baster is poorly designed and likely subject to wide manufacturing standards. Mine disassembled and assembled easily when following the instructions (to ease in cleaning), but the bulb does not fit snugly enough to prevent air from entering the top of the unit. Even with the collar snapped into place air leaked in and allowed liquid to drip out. (The size of the hole is normal and is not the problem as reported by another reviewer.) Loose manufacturing tolerances probably allows for some to come through without significant air leakage. Do you feel lucky?

I replaced it with a $1.69 supermarket baster which works great. Except
for its cleaning brush I threw the OXO out.

1.0 out of 5 stars Can't take the heat, keep it out of the kitchen, August 28, 2008
By 
Avid Rita (Cambridge, MA United States) - See all my reviews
This review is from: OXO Good Grips Turkey Baster with Cleaning Brush (Kitchen)
Up until now I've had good luck with Oxo products -- thought I'd like this initially, easy to get the bulb on and off, great cleaning with that brush. BUT. The tip drips much worse than basters I've used in past, the bulb pops off occasionally when using -- there's a mess. Today is the worst: using it to siphon off fat from roasting short ribs, THE PLASTIC TUBE STARTED MELTING. The clear plastic part actually started to curve, and the tip melted together almost shut. Had to throw it away. Just ordered the Tovolo here, which had good reviews.
